From: Impacts of autofluorescence on fluorescence based techniques to study microglia

Fig. 1

Gating strategies and detection of LAG-3 expression by FITC conjugated LAG-3 antibody. A Gating strategy of isolating single CD11+/CD45low cells from the brains of PBS injected mice. Single-cell suspension from the brains of naïve mice involved pre-gating by forward scatter area (FSC-A) vs. side scatter area (SSC-A) plot, and forward scatter height (FSC-H) vs. FSC-A density plot to select singlets. Microglia were then identified by the high expression of CD11b and the low expression of CD45. B Distribution of fluorescence intensities from FITC conjugated LAG-3 antibody and isotype control antibody treated microglia. C Gating strategy of isolating single CD11+/CD45low microglia cells and CD11/CD45high lymphocytes from the brains of LPS injected mice. D, E Distribution of fluorescence intensities from FITC conjugated LAG-3 and isotype control antibody-treated microglia (D) and lymphocytes (E) from LPS injected mice. All data were replicated in four independent experiments
